Overview of Hedera (HBAR) Market Movements

Hedera Hashgraph's native token HBAR has recently experienced significant volatility, capturing the attention of traders and investors. The asset has been fluctuating between key support and resistance levels, creating both opportunities and challenges for market participants.

Over the past 24 hours, HBAR demonstrated several interesting technical patterns. The trading session began with a golden cross at 00:15 UTC, suggesting upward momentum within a moderate trading range. However, this positive movement encountered resistance at $0.20131. A death cross at 3:10 UTC initiated a downward trend, further reinforced by an oversold RSI reading at 7:30 UTC.

The price found support at $0.17563 around 11:30 UTC, followed by another golden cross at 11:35 UTC that helped initiate a bounce. Additional bullish signals emerged with another golden cross at 19:40 UTC, coupled with an overbought RSI, which pushed prices higher and led to another brief test of resistance around 22:05 UTC.

Later in the trading session, a death cross at 23:30 UTC triggered a significant decline that continued into the next day with a slight downward trend. While a golden cross at 1:00 UTC suggested potential upward movement, an oversold RSI at 3:15 UTC pushed the price back to $0.20176, where it struggled to break through resistance. The MACD death cross at 3:40 UTC indicated potential further declines. Traders are now watching closely to see whether HBAR will fall toward the $0.17563 support level or attempt another breakthrough at the $0.20176 resistance level.

Key Considerations for Cryptocurrency Investment

Before exploring specific projects, it's important to understand the fundamental factors that contribute to successful cryptocurrency investments:

Technology and Innovation: The underlying technology should offer genuine improvements over existing solutions, whether through scalability, security, or novel applications.

Market Potential: The project should address a substantial market need or create new market opportunities with clear use cases.

Team and Development: A capable development team with relevant experience increases the likelihood of project success and timely delivery of roadmap milestones.

Tokenomics: The token distribution model, utility, and economic incentives should create sustainable value for holders.

Community and Adoption: Growing community support and early adoption signals indicate market validation and potential for future growth.

What is the difference between resistance and support levels?
Support levels represent price points where buying interest typically emerges, preventing further decline. Resistance levels indicate prices where selling pressure historically increases, preventing upward movement. These levels form through repeated market interactions and often become self-reinforcing as traders watch these key levels.

Are presale investments riskier than established cryptocurrencies?
Presale investments typically carry higher risk due to earlier development stages, less market history, and lower liquidity. However, they also offer potential for greater returns if projects succeed. Investors should allocate only risk capital to presales and conduct thorough due diligence before participating.
